Mitt Romney won't fight for gay people. He's against gay marriage, he's said that he will allow DADT to stand if he becomes president though he wasn't "comfortable" with it, and he won't stand up for his gay employees when they are targeted by religious conservative groups. But it looks like gay Republicans will fight for Mitt Romney. Last night, GOProud voted to endorse him in the 2012 presidential race:

In a statement, the group for gay conservatives and their allies announced it had “enthusiastically,” but not unanimously, decided to back Romney despite his support for an amendment to the U.S. Constitution that would limit marriage to the union of one man and one woman.

“GOProud is prepared to commit significant resources to help make Mitt Romney the next President of the United States,” said Lisa De Pasquale, interim GOProud board chair and former CPAC director...“Not only does President Obama not understand how the free markets work – he is openly hostile to free market capitalism,” said Jimmy LaSalvia, GOProud executive director.
